Say Goodbye to Remote Clutter with Smart Universal Control
One of the most persistent frustrations in any home entertainment setup is the sheer number of remotes. Every new device—from your TV and soundbar to your Blu-ray player and streaming box—seems to come with its own dedicated controller, leading to a cluttered coffee table and a constant scavenger hunt. The problem isn’t just aesthetic; it’s a barrier to enjoying your system, as simple actions become multi-step operations involving several different devices. It’s a classic example of technology creating more complexity rather than less.
However, devices like Anymote Home offer a compelling solution by bridging the gap between your smartphone and your infrared (IR) home electronics. This innovative approach centralizes control directly onto the device you already carry everywhere: your phone. Imagine if your most useful commands, like adjusting volume or changing channels, were always within arm’s reach, instantly accessible without fumbling through a pile of plastic. Instead of searching for the specific remote for your TV, then your sound system, and then your streaming stick, you simply tap an icon on your phone.
The power of such a system extends far beyond basic remote replacement. Consider the possibilities for home automation: you could easily schedule your TV to automatically switch to your favorite news channel just before it starts, ensuring you never miss an important update. Furthermore, the ability to control devices from anywhere in the house, or even around it, without having them in sight, introduces an unparalleled level of convenience. Imagine you’re in the kitchen, and your kids are still watching TV in the living room; a quick tap on your phone can turn it off without you needing to enter the room.
For movie night, the transition from everyday viewing to an immersive cinematic experience becomes effortless. Instead of manually powering on your TV, receiver, and Blu-ray player, then adjusting the lights, a “movie watching mode” could be just one button press away on your phone, orchestrating all these actions simultaneously. This level of smart control simplifies complex routines into intuitive, single-tap actions. The ability to automatically pause your media when your phone rings, or to turn off everything with a single tap as you leave the house, underscores the profound impact these **TV gadgets** have on daily life, making technology serve you rather than the other way around.
Bringing Mobile Gaming to the Big Screen: The Evolution of Play
For years, a fundamental disconnect existed between the vibrant world of mobile gaming and the immersive potential of the big screen. Smartphones boast access to literally millions of awesome games, a vast and ever-growing library covering every genre imaginable. Yet, playing these games on a small phone screen, while convenient, often falls short of delivering a truly engaging experience. The sheer scale and detail that a large television could offer remained tantalizingly out of reach for mobile titles, despite numerous attempts to bridge this gap.
Early solutions, such as Android TV kits, faced significant hurdles, primarily with their controllers. Traditional gamepads, while excellent for console-style games, proved clunky and unintuitive for titles designed specifically for touch interaction. Imagine trying to play a fast-paced puzzle game or a strategy game, originally designed for precise finger taps and swipes, using a joystick and buttons; the experience quickly becomes frustrating and unsatisfying. The developers realized that touch games, by their very nature, were meant to be played with touch.
Subsequent efforts involved using the smartphone itself as a controller, but this merely shifted the problem. Users found themselves staring at their phone screen, effectively making the huge TV screen irrelevant—a visually impressive but functionally useless backdrop. Even crowdfunded initiatives for special Android gaming consoles for TV, while initially met with excitement, quickly disappointed. These consoles often lacked touch capabilities entirely and offered a paltry selection of only about 50 games, a stark contrast to the millions available on mobile. Users rightly clamored for the full breadth of their mobile gaming libraries on the big screen.
This persistent demand for a genuine mobile gaming experience on TV has finally been met by innovations like ZRRO Z-Touch technology. This revolutionary approach tackles the control problem head-on by introducing a unique Hover Pad Controller. Imagine a controller that mirrors the position of your fingers onto the TV screen as they float above it, allowing you to “touch” the screen from the comfort of your couch without actually looking at your hands. This multi-hover technology eliminates the need for physical contact, delivering a seamless and intuitive experience that brings mobile games, exactly as they are designed, to any television. It truly opens up the “one million games” to the grand canvas of your TV, allowing for an immersive and expansive mobile gaming session, finally marrying the best of both worlds.
Transforming Your Television into a Giant Touchscreen: The Interactive Leap
While gaming brings a specific form of interaction to the big screen, the potential for a truly versatile, interactive television experience extends far beyond. Our smartphones and tablets have accustomed us to a world where we can tap, swipe, and pinch our way through content. Yet, for many years, our televisions remained largely passive displays, controlled by simple button presses. This created a stark contrast between the dynamic digital interfaces we use daily and the comparatively static interaction with our primary home screen. The desire for a more direct, tactile relationship with our TV content was evident.
The Touchjet WAVE represents a significant leap forward in bridging this gap, effectively turning any television into a smart touchscreen. Imagine the possibilities: with this device, your TV becomes a massive tablet, capable of doing pretty much anything you can do on your phone or tablet, but on a much grander scale. You can stream any movie from your preferred services, browse the web, or check sports scores and news with a simple touch. The device’s integration with the Google Play Store means you can download virtually any app directly onto the WAVE, from productivity tools to educational games and social media platforms.
This transformation doesn’t just enhance individual viewing; it revolutionizes collaborative and family interactions. Imagine a scenario where kids are playing educational games together on a giant touchscreen, engaging with content in a completely new, hands-on way. Or consider an office environment, where colleagues can collaborate on presentations or brainstorming sessions directly on a large interactive display, moving beyond the constraints of individual screens. The Specter Project mentioned in the video, where people collaborate like never before, perfectly illustrates this potential for shared, interactive experiences that get people out of their chairs.
Moreover, the Touchjet WAVE integrates seamlessly with your existing mobile devices through its dedicated app. You can swipe files, photos, and videos directly from your Android or Apple device right to the TV, eliminating compatibility headaches and making media sharing effortless. This device, building on the success of Touchjet’s crowdfunded touchscreen projector, has already shipped thousands of units globally, a testament to its practical utility and widespread appeal. The ability to navigate content and even control your home from a massive, interactive display fundamentally changes how we think about and use our televisions, evolving them into truly interactive **TV gadgets** for entertainment, learning, and collaboration.
Seamless Connectivity: Unlocking Your Phone’s Full Potential on TV
In our increasingly mobile-centric world, the smartphone has become the primary hub for content creation and consumption. We capture photos and videos, stream movies, and play games all on these powerful, pocket-sized devices. However, the experience of trying to share that content with others, or simply enjoying it on a larger display, often presented a challenge. Wireless casting solutions could be unreliable, requiring specific apps or suffering from lag, while older wired connections were cumbersome and device-specific. There was a clear need for a simple, universally compatible solution to connect a phone to a TV, effectively making portable media truly shareable media.
This is where technologies like SlimPort offer an elegant and effective solution. SlimPort cables allow you to connect your phone directly to your TV using a simple, robust wired connection, transforming your small screen into a large, immersive display. Imagine never missing a crucial play in the game because you’re away from your main TV; with SlimPort, you can connect your phone to any available display and enjoy sports in stunning Full HD and even 4K resolution. This capability means your phone isn’t just a content source; it’s a portable media player capable of delivering high-quality visuals to any compatible screen.
The beauty of SlimPort lies in its simplicity and universal applicability across various devices, providing a reliable alternative to wireless casting which can sometimes be inconsistent due to network conditions or software compatibility. This technology truly makes media portable again, enabling users to easily share their experiences, photos, videos, and even presentations without relying on complex network setups or proprietary ecosystems. Imagine hosting an impromptu photo slideshow on your living room TV, directly from your phone, with crisp 4K clarity. Or perhaps you need to give a last-minute presentation; simply connect your phone to a monitor and project your content seamlessly.
Such straightforward connectivity empowers users to unlock the full potential of their smartphones, ensuring that the rich media stored or streamed on their mobile devices can be effortlessly enjoyed on the largest screen available. It underlines a broader trend in **TV gadgets** development: creating uncomplicated bridges between our personal devices and shared entertainment spaces, ensuring that content created on the go can be displayed and enjoyed with equal quality and ease in the comfort of our homes.
